Transaction e765706ccdf9287dc934319f9f82c99de85c30fdba0e043e62b7372f6c6e6e27

1 Input
1 Outputs
  • e765706ccdf9287dc934319f9f82c99de85c30fdba0e043e62b7372f6c6e6e27:0
  • value  434788
    address  3Cz164LYeDBNbzMJXY2Uj9K8snajqERHsD